WebJul 21, 2024 · Definition noun, singular: somatic cell The word “somatic” is derived from the Greek word soma, meaning “body”. Hence, all body cells of an organism – apart from the sperm and egg cells, the cells from which they arise (gametocytes) and undifferentiated stem cells – are somatic cells. WebFeb 10, 2024 · High red blood cell count: A high red blood cell count is an increase in oxygen-carrying cells in your bloodstream. Red blood cells transport oxygen from your lungs to tissues throughout your body. A high red blood cell count can result from a condition that limits your oxygen supply or a condition that directly increases red blood cell production. Familial erythrocytosis is an inherited condition characterized by an increased number of red blood cells (erythrocytes). The primary function of these cells is to carry oxygen from the lungs to tissues and organs throughout the body.
